Zonta Club of Hualien II holds February meeting and Lunar New Year celebration
The Zonta Club of Hualien II, Taiwan, celebrated its February meeting and Lunar New Year costume party at the Hualien Parkview Hotel, highlighting key achievements and fostering international collaboration.
During the meeting, Club President Daisy Chen recognized three major milestones:
- Successful fundraising efforts led by members and Zonta Girl Scholarship recipients for charity.
- A Zoom meeting with the Zonta Club of Ibadan I, Nigeria, to establish a sister club partnership.
- The Zonta Girls Shining Stars Scholarship, supporting female students in remote areas, was featured in The Zontian magazine as the only global education equity project recognized.
The club also distributed its Charter Handbook, outlining both international and local initiatives.
A highlight of the evening was a special talk by Cheng Wei-Sheng, leader of the Against the Wind Theatre Group, who shared his inspiring journey from a troubled youth to a community leader. The club had previously donated to the theater group, but the members found themselves equally inspired by its work—embodying the Zonta spirit of giving and empowerment.
The Lunar New Year costume party, hosted by team leader Chang Hsiang-Ling, featured creative performances, friendly competitions and a lively raffle with prizes donated by members. A Zonta knowledge quiz also engaged attendees, reinforcing their understanding of the organization.
